Using an estimated 3500 samples – from classics like Madonna's "Holiday" and Kid Creole and the Coconuts' "Stool Pigeon," as well as hard-to-recognize hip-hop, funk, easy-listening and cheese-jazz records – they created a concept album about getting over a breakup by embarking on an island cruise. The Aussie trio tapped into the Beach Boys/ De La Soul tradition of all-smiles cuteness for what might be the blissiest album in dance music history. "Welcome to Paradise," a voice invites us at the opening of the Avalanches' debut.
